Quick Answer: What Is Artificial Intelligence?

Artificial intelligence refers to computer systems designed to perform tasks that would typically require human intelligence. These systems learn from data, recognize patterns, and make decisions or predictions—without being explicitly programmed for every scenario. From voice assistants to recommendation engines, AI is everywhere in our daily lives.

Breaking Down AI Basics: What You Need to Know

The term artificial intelligence covers a broad range of technologies and approaches, but here are the core components that help you understand AI better:

1. Machine Learning: The Heart of AI

Machine learning is a subset of AI where computers use algorithms to learn from data and improve over time. Instead of hard-coding rules, these systems find patterns on their own. For example, a spam filter in your email learns from past emails to identify unwanted messages.

2. Neural Networks and Deep Learning

Think of neural networks as AI’s attempt to mimic the human brain. They connect layers of “neurons” to analyze data at multiple levels. Deep learning, a type of neural network, powers things like image recognition and natural language processing—allowing AI to understand photos or text with impressive accuracy.

3. Natural Language Processing (NLP)

NLP helps machines understand and generate human language. When you talk to Siri or Alexa, NLP is what makes those conversations possible by interpreting your words and responding in kind.

Frequently Asked Questions About Artificial Intelligence

What is the difference between AI and machine learning?

AI is the broader concept of machines exhibiting intelligence, while machine learning is a method of achieving AI through data-driven algorithms.

Can AI replace human jobs?

AI automates repetitive tasks but also creates new job opportunities focused on AI management and innovation. It’s more about collaboration than replacement.

Is AI expensive to implement?

Costs vary widely. Some AI tools have free tiers or affordable plans, making AI accessible even to small businesses or individual users.

How is AI used in everyday life?

From voice assistants and recommendation engines to fraud detection and smart home devices, AI is integrated into many daily technologies.
